Oncomodulation by human cytomegalovirus: evidence becomes stronger

Authors: Martin Michaelis, Hans Wilhelm Doerr, Jindrich Cinatl Jr

Published in: Medical Microbiology and Immunology | Issue 2/2009

Login to get access

Excerpt

The human cytomegalovirus (HCMV), a ubiquitous herpes virus, establishes after (in healthy individuals typically subclinical) primary infection a lifelong persistence characterised by more or less frequent subclinical reactivations. It is an important pathogen in immunocompromised individuals and currently investigated for a plethora of different questions and aspects [125]. The (possible) relationship between HCMV and cancer has been discussed for decades [1]. Detection of viral DNA, mRNA and/or antigens in tumour tissues as well as seroepidemiologic evidence suggested a role of HCMV infection in several human malignancies. However, controversial clinical results from different groups had raised skepticism about a role of HCMV in cancer [1]. …
